java里sql语句是如何提交的

java里sql语句是如何提交的

作者:Elara发布时间:2026-02-14阅读时长:0 分钟阅读次数:2

用户关注问题

Q
Java中如何执行SQL查询?

我想了解在Java程序中,如何使用代码来执行SQL查询语句?需要哪些关键步骤?

A

Java中执行SQL查询的步骤

在Java中执行SQL查询主要通过JDBC(Java Database Connectivity)完成。关键步骤包括:首先,加载数据库驱动;接着,建立数据库连接;然后,创建Statement或PreparedStatement对象;之后,执行SQL查询语句并获取结果集;最后,处理结果并关闭相关资源。

Q
Java代码提交SQL语句时需要注意什么?

在用Java代码提交SQL语句时,有哪些常见的注意事项或者容易出现的问题?

A

提交SQL语句时的注意事项

提交SQL语句时,应避免SQL注入风险,可以使用PreparedStatement防止恶意输入。另外,要保证数据库连接正确关闭,否则可能导致资源泄漏。执行更新操作后,需要检查执行结果以确认操作成功。异常处理也很重要,能够帮助捕获并处理数据库操作中出现的问题。

Q
Java中执行SQL语句的不同方式有哪些?

能介绍一下在Java代码中提交SQL语句,有哪些不同的执行方式吗?

A

Java执行SQL的方式

主要有使用Statement和PreparedStatement两种方式。Statement适合执行静态SQL语句,但不安全且效率较低。PreparedStatement支持动态参数绑定,不仅预防SQL注入,还能提升性能。此外,还有CallableStatement用于调用存储过程,适合复杂的数据库操作。